1
In the course of time, David defeated the Philistines and subdued them,
and he took Gath and its surrounding villages from the control of the Philistines.
2
David also defeated the Moabites, and they became subject to him and
brought tribute.
3
Moreover, David fought Hadadezer king of Zobah, as far as Hamath, when he
went to establish his control along the Euphrates River.
4
David captured a thousand of his chariots, seven thousand charioteers and twenty
thousand foot soldiers. He hamstrung all but a hundred of the chariot horses.
5
When the Arameans of Damascus came to help Hadadezer king of Zobah, David
struck down twenty-two thousand of them.
6
He put garrisons in the Aramean kingdom of Damascus, and the Arameans became
subject to him and brought tribute. The LORD gave David victory everywhere he went.
7
David took the gold shields carried by the officers of Hadadezer and brought them
to Jerusalem.
8
From Tebah and Cun, towns that belonged to Hadadezer, David took a great
quantity of bronze, which Solomon used to make the bronze Sea, the pillars and
various bronze articles.
9
When Tou king of Hamath heard that David had defeated the entire army of
Hadadezer king of Zobah,
10
he sent his son Hadoram to King David to greet him and congratulate him on his
victory in battle over Hadadezer, who had been at war with Tou. Hadoram brought
all kinds of articles of gold and silver and bronze.
11
King David dedicated these articles to the LORD, as he had done with the silver
and gold he had taken from all these nations: Edom and Moab, the Ammonites
and the Philistines, and Amalek.
12
Abishai son of Zeruiah struck down eighteen thousand Edomites in the Valley of Salt.
13
He put garrisons in Edom, and all the Edomites became subject to David. The LORD
gave David victory everywhere he went.
14
David reigned over all Israel, doing what was just and right for all his people.
15
Joab son of Zeruiah was over the army; Jehoshaphat son of Ahihud was recoeder;
16
Zadok son of Ahutub and Ahimelech son of Abiathar were priests; Shavsha was
secretary;
17
Benaiah son of Jehoiada was over the Kerethites and Pelethites;
and David's sons were chief officials at the king's side.
